Costing and Warranties for Professional Tinting

When it comes to professional window tinting, pricing isn't always straightforward. The size and type of the vehicle, as well as the client's particular needs, can have a significant impact on the price. It isn't just about applying a layer of tint; it's an intricate process that requires attention to detail and expertise. Therefore, obtaining quotes from multiple professional window tinting shops is vital. This allows for a thorough comparison of prices, ensuring you receive the best value for your investment.


Additionally, the type of tint material selected can impact the overall cost. High-quality ceramic films may be pricier due to their advanced heat rejection capabilities and durability, while basic dyed films may be more budget-friendly but offer fewer benefits in terms of UV protection and heat reduction. For instance, a sedan might have different pricing than an SUV due to differences in the number and size of windows, affecting both material usage and labor requirements. While these varying factors can make determining an exact price challenging, a professional installer should be able to provide a detailed breakdown of costs based on your vehicle's specifications.


Another significant aspect to consider when opting for professional tinting services is the warranty offered. Reputable installers, such as Acap Films, often provide warranties that cover both the tint material and the installation itself. These warranties act as a form of assurance against potential issues such as peeling, discoloration, or bubbling that might occur after installation. A warranty for the tint material can safeguard against color fading, protecting your investment in the long run. Conversely, warranties covering installation ensure that any issues resulting from faulty applications are addressed at no extra cost to you.


If you notice bubbles forming beneath the installed film, a comprehensive warranty would entitle you to have this issue rectified without incurring any additional expenses. The availability of strong warranties not only adds peace of mind but also reflects the confidence that professional installers have in their products and workmanship.

Cons of DIY Window Tinting

First things first, let's address the elephant in the room: skill and precision. Tinting your car windows isn't just about cutting a piece of film and sticking it on. It demands precision, patience, and meticulous attention to detail. To achieve that professional finish, you'll need steady hands, good eyesight, and familiarity with the tools of the trade. And speaking of tools, having the right equipment is crucial. Cutting the film accurately and applying it without mistakes demands specialized tools like squeegees, heat guns, and very sharp blades. Even an unsteady hand can lead to costly errors on your car's windows.


It's not just about having the right tools; it's about using them correctly. DIY projects often result in issues such as bubbling, creasing, and misalignment. These imperfections can detract from the appearance and functionality of the tint. Bubbles are particularly common in DIY attempts, with some resulting in air bubbles. Additionally, some DIY window tinting attempts end up with uneven applications of tint.


What's more, the legal responsibility for compliance with state window tinting laws falls squarely on your shoulders when you opt for a DIY approach. If your tint doesn’t meet the legal requirements for light transmittance, you could face hefty fines or even have to remove and replace the tint. Consider this: You might apply window tint to your vehicle only to find it peeling or discoloring within a few months due to inadequate installation or the use of subpar materials.  So while DIY projects can be appealing for their cost-saving potential, they're not without their risks and challenges. The margin for error is high, leaving room for imperfections like bubbles and misalignment that can diminish the overall look and functionality of your vehicle's windows.
